## Step 4: Reconfigure the bounce processor

After migrating Larkmail's queues, the Finchgate bounce processor must be repointed before traffic resumes. The legacy shared-secret handshake is removed in this release; the processor now authenticates with short-lived tokens minted by the platform broker, and all suppression writes are audited. Verify that the old credentials are revoked and that retry limits match policy before sign-off. Apply the following configuration values to each processor instance.

settings of fafog-haduf:
ZORIX_PIN=4648
ZORIX_METRICS_HOST=metrics.zorix.paliqsys.corp
ZORIX_LOG_LEVEL=info
ZORIX_TENANT=druix

Audit item: we finally vendored the third-party fonts for the Mossgate UI instead of pulling them from that flaky CDN at runtime. Security angle: please confirm the checksums in the vendored bundle match the upstream release, and that the license files made it into the repo. Also worth a quick look at whether the old fetch-at-boot code path is fully dead, not just disabled. Once that's verified we can close this out. The responsible engineer is named below.

approver of bagug-bagag = Holael Pramir

## Service Accounts — Build Agent Clock Skew

Quick refresher: the Tickmark sync service keeps our Brindle build agents within 200ms of each other. When skew alarms fire, support can query agent drift via the `/skew` endpoint using the shared service account — no need to page infra first. The account is read-only, so poke around freely. Its current key is pasted below.

service key, tadup-tahog: zpat7_wB1tnEL

Contractors visiting Brindlewood House may book the second-floor wellness room only through the front desk. Sessions run thirty minutes, maximum one per day. No tools, food, or equipment inside. Leave the room as found; report any issues to reception immediately. Bookings lapse if you arrive more than five minutes late. The door remains locked at all times outside confirmed slots. To enter during your booked session, use the pass code below.

door code, tahop-fahap: bdg-JZCXMY-37375484